Ingredients


– 2 medium zucchini
– 1 cup ricotta cheese
– 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 tablespoon fresh basil, chopped
– 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
– ½ teaspoon nutmeg
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Olive oil, for sautéing
– Marinara sauce, for serving (optional)
– Optional toppings: Fresh herbs or shaved Parmesan cheese

Step-by-Step Instructions


Follow these simple steps to create Zucchini Ravioli that will delight your family and friends:
1. Prepare Zucchini: Slice the zucchini lengthwise into thin “noodles” using a mandoline or a sharp knife. Aim for thin strips, about 1/8 inch thick.
2. Make Filling: In a bowl, combine ricotta cheese, grated Parmesan cheese, chopped basil, chopped parsley, nutmeg, salt, and pepper. Mix until smooth and well blended.
3. Assemble Ravioli: Take one zucchini slice, place a spoonful of the cheese mixture on one end, and fold the zucchini slice over the filling. Press down gently to seal. Repeat for the remaining filling and zucchini slices.
4. Cook Ravioli: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the zucchini ravioli in batches and sauté for about 2-3 minutes on each side until softened and slightly golden.
5. Serve: Gently transfer cooked ravioli to serving plates. Top with marinara sauce if desired, and finish with fresh herbs or shaved Parmesan cheese for added flavor.

Additional Tips


Slice Uniformly: Make sure to slice the zucchini uniformly for even cooking and a more appealing presentation.
Experiment with Herbs: Feel free to add other herbs, such as oregano or thyme, to the filling for a different flavor profile.
Use Non-Stick Cookware: This prevents the ravioli from sticking to the pan and allows for easier flipping and removal.
Consider Grating Zucchini: For a different texture, you can grate the zucchini instead of slicing it. This will create a more traditional ‘ravioli’ style.

Recipe Variation


Zucchini Ravioli is quite versatile, so don’t hesitate to try out these variations:
1. Meat Filling: Add cooked, seasoned ground beef or turkey to the ricotta filling for a heartier option.
2. Vegan Option: Substitute the ricotta with a mixture of blended nuts or tofu, along with nutritional yeast for a cheesy flavor.
3. Different Cheese Blends: Experiment with goat cheese or feta for a tangy twist in the filling.
4. Sauce Variations: Swap marinara for a sage brown butter sauce or a creamy Alfredo sauce to complement the ravioli flavors.

Freezing and Storage


Storage: If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ge. They will keep for 2-3 days.
Freezing: Zucchini Ravioli can be frozen before cooking for up to 2 months. Lay the assembled ravioli on a baking sheet and freeze until solid, then transfer to a freezer bag.
Reheating: For best results, reheat in a pan over medium heat until warmed through. Add a splash of water to create steam and help re-soften the ravioli.

Frequently Asked Questions



Can I use other vegetables besides zucchini?


Yes! You can experiment with eggplant or yellow squash for a unique twist on the dish.

How can I reduce excess moisture in the zucchini?


After slicing the zucchini, sprinkle salt over it and let it sit for about 10 minutes. This draws out moisture which you can then pat dry.

Can I prepare this dish in advance?


Absolutely! You can assemble your Zucchini Ravioli a day ahead. Just store them in the fridge and cook them right before serving.

Is it possible to grill the zucchini instead of sautéing it?


Yes! Grilling the zucchini can enhance its flavor and give a lovely char that adds to the overall taste of the dish.

What can I do with leftover filling?


You can use any extra filling to make a dip for crackers or veggies. Simply add some herbs and spices to taste.
